"I went for the midnight brunch avalible only select days during Knotts Scary Farm
The entrance for the midnight brunch is at the back. Opposite of the main entrance.
It was of course delicious. The must haves were the boysenberry sausages and biscuits with boysenberry jam. Everything else was filler.
Coffee was hot and had a good flavor and the juices was ice cold super good.
Plastic utensils were provided with sturdy disposable plates.
No other toppings for the scrambled eggs other than salt pepper and ketchup.
Parking is $40.
This midnight brunch about 24 per person.
All in all not bad especially if you don't like crowds but miss a buffet setting.
There is a choice of:
Waffles
Pancakes
Biscuits
Scrambled eggs
Country fried potatoes
Fried chicken thighs and legs
Bacon
Boysenberry Sasuage
Sasage gravy
Boysenberry jam
Hot syrup
Fruit
Coffee
Orange juice
Apple juice
Water"

"Family atmosphere, waitress had amazing customer service. Had to try the famous 100 year old fried chicken recipe. It didn't disappoint, it was literally the best fried chicken ive ever had. Crunchy, crispy, juice seasoned perfectly, portions are so big. Breast, wing, thigh, leg. Mashed potatoes perfection, strawberry rhubarb side and cabbage and ham, 6 biscuits with boysenberry Jam. And comes with pie slice. Under $26.00 could feed two. Additionally $8.00 to split the plat but worth it if you want to share. Kid, had the sliders, equally as good. I wish we had this restaurant in Oregon. 10 out of 10."

🍽️ 🍽️ Food & Dining
The restaurant is most famous for its Mrs. Knott's Famous Fried Chicken, a recipe that's been around for decades. They are also known for their boysenberry-themed dishes and desserts.
The traditional dinner typically includes fried chicken pieces, mashed potatoes with gravy, cabbage with ham, rhubarb, salad, biscuits with boysenberry jam, and a slice of boysenberry pie.
While the fried chicken is the star, sides like mashed potatoes, gravy, salad, and biscuits can be enjoyed by vegetarians. The boysenberry pie is also a vegetarian-friendly dessert.
You'll find boysenberry jam served with biscuits, boysenberry pie for dessert, and sometimes boysenberry sausages or other specialty items during seasonal events.

Seasonal Dining Experiences
Another highlight is the Boysenberry Brunch, typically offered during the annual Boysenberry Festival. This special brunch features an expanded menu with breakfast classics, carving stations, omelet bars, and even boysenberry champagne. It's a festive way to celebrate the season and indulge in a variety of delicious dishes.
During the holiday season, the restaurant also hosts events like Breakfast with Santa, allowing families to enjoy a festive buffet and create memorable holiday moments. These seasonal offerings add an extra layer of appeal to the already popular restaurant, making it a destination for year-round celebrations.
